A man of mass m starts falling towards a planet of mass M and radius R . As he reaches near to the surface, he realizes that he will pass through a small hole in the planet. As he enters the hole, he sees that the planet is really made of two pieces a spherical shell of negligible thickness of mass 2 M / 3 and a point mass M / 3 at the centre. Change in the force of gravity experienced by the man is
Options
- A2 3 GMm R ²
- B0
- C1 3 GMm R ²
- D4 3 GMm R ²
Correct answer
A. 2 3 GMm R ²
Step-by-step solution
Change in force of gravity = GMm R ² - G M 3 ~m R ² (only due to mass M / 3 due to shell gravitational field is zero (inside the shell)) = 2 GMm 3 R ²
